What are the Seattle Seahawks?

The Seattle Seahawks are a professional American football team based in Seattle, Washington. They compete in the National Football League (NFL) as a member of the league's NFC West division. The team was established in 1976 and has since become known for its passionate fan base, often referred to as the '12s' or '12th Man.' The Seahawks play their home games at Lumen Field and have appeared in three Super Bowls, winning their first championship in Super Bowl XLVIII.

The Role

As our IT and Desktop Support Specialist, you'll be a key member of our Technology team, keeping the people, devices, and everyday tools that our company runs on working smoothly. One day you're setting up a new hire's laptop, the next you're resolving a WiFi issue in a conference room, resetting an MFA prompt, or helping a teammate get access to the software they need. You'll be the friendly, reliable face of IT day to day, with plenty of room to grow your skills and take on more responsibility over time.

Responsibilities:
  • Provide day-to-day technical support to team members across our offices and remote staff, resolving hardware, software, network and application issues
  • Install, upgrade, and troubleshoot hardware and software systems including office networks, laptops, WiFi and conference room technology, and manage the device lifecycle from procurement through MDM enrollment, repair and retirement
  • Provide on-boarding for new employees, and off-boarding for departing employees or internal changes in roles, including complete and timely access revocation
  • Administer Microsoft 365 and Microsoft Entra, including accounts, licensing, groups, multi-factor authentication, conditional access, and mail routing and security
  • Administer our SaaS platforms, with Rippling and Drata central and growing, alongside 1Password, GitHub, Jira, Confluence, Zendesk and Slack. Expect these platforms to take on more of the device, account and onboarding lifecycle over time, and to own how that gets built out
  • Provision and maintain the customer-facing infrastructure our platform depends on, including e-ticket email accounts, phone numbers, distribution lists and per-customer email branding
  • Maintain and troubleshoot the one-time-passcode forwarding path customers use to authenticate to third-party ticketing platforms
  • Manage DNS, domains and certificates across our company domains, and support our cloud environment alongside the Technology team
  • Run quarterly user access reviews and keep our compliance evidence in order
  • Build integrations and automation between our platforms to reduce repetitive manual work
  • Document procedures for procedure that other may need to perform
Desired Skills and Experience:
  • Bachelor’s degree required, preferably in Information Technology, Computer Science, Information Systems, Computer Engineering, or a related technical field
  • 1–3 years of experience in an IT help desk, desktop support, or technical support role
  • Strong Microsoft 365 and Microsoft Entra administration experience. Identity, licensing, groups and mail security should be second nature
  • Experience managing Windows endpoints at scale, including device build, MDM enrollment, disk encryption and patching
  • Experience administering a broad SaaS estate, including user provisioning and deprovisioning
  • Working knowledge of a cloud environment such as AWS, particularly identity and access management, storage and certificates. Architecture-level depth is not required
  • Able to troubleshoot problems that span several vendors and systems at once, where the answer is not in any one product's documentation
  • Working knowledge of service desk ticketing software, e.g., Zendesk, Jira
  • Some familiarity with DNS and email deliverability, such as SPF, DKIM and DMARC. Depth here is welcome but not expected, and we are happy to teach it
  • Strong documentation habits. Writing runbooks that someone else can follow is part of the role
  • Experience with an HR and IT platform such as Rippling, particularly device management and application provisioning, is highly desirable
  • Experience with telephony platforms or messaging APIs, Jira and Atlassian administration, or scripting for automation, is desirable
  • Self-motivated, takes ownership, and thrives in an entrepreneurial, autonomous environment
  • Excellent interpersonal, organizational, verbal and written communication skills
